如何查看localStorage中的内容,例如Google Chrome:资源 - >本地存储
(我的意思是在FF开发工具,而不是Firebug)
好吧,我使用5 Min QUICKSTART创建了一个基本的Angular 2 Typescript项目,它已启动并运行.
我的typescript transpiller配置为创建源映射:
tsconfig.js
{
"compilerOptions": {
"target": "es5",
"module": "commonjs",
"moduleResolution": "node",
"sourceMap": true,
"emitDecoratorMetadata": true,
"experimentalDecorators": true,
"removeComments": false,
"noImplicitAny": false
}
}
Run Code Online (Sandbox Code Playgroud)
现在我可以在Chrome中看到*.ts文件,并且可以调试它们,没有任何问题.但Firefox(以及FireFox Developer Edition)根本没有显示.ts文件,即使在调试器选项中选中了"显示原始源".
javascript firefox typescript firefox-developer-tools firefox-developer-edition
我正在尝试为浏览器的Web扩展测试示例代码.但是,它不起作用.我检查了控制台的谷歌浏览器和Firefox.它不打印任何东西.以下是我的代码:
manifest.json:
{
"description": "Demonstrating webRequests",
"manifest_version": 2,
"name": "webRequest-demo",
"version": "1.0",
"permissions": [
"webRequest"
],
"background": {
"scripts": ["background.js"]
}
}
Run Code Online (Sandbox Code Playgroud)
background.js:
function logURL(requestDetails) {
console.log("Loading: " + requestDetails.url);
}
chrome.webRequest.onBeforeRequest.addListener(
logURL,
{urls: ["<all_urls>"]}
);
console.log("Hell o extension background script executed");
Run Code Online (Sandbox Code Playgroud)
我错过了什么吗?
firefox-addon google-chrome-extension google-chrome-devtools firefox-developer-tools firefox-addon-webextensions
我有一个<input type="hidden">。我需要看看它的值何时发生变化。我有很多 JavaScript 文件正在改变它的值。
我可以去任何值发生更改的地方并添加语句debugger,但这会花费很多时间。我已经了解了Object.watch()但它只在值更改后执行特定函数,尽管我想查看它在代码中更改的位置,而不是何时更改。
有什么方法可以实现这一点,也许是通过输出行号和 JavaScript 文件名或停止 Web 浏览器中的调试器?
javascript firebug developer-tools google-chrome-devtools firefox-developer-tools
有没有人知道如何在Firefox开发人员工具上打破XHR请求?在firebug的早些时候,我在Net面板下添加了断点.随着firebug的停止,感谢Firefox开发人员工具的任何解决方法.
javascript ajax firefox xmlhttprequest firefox-developer-tools
我为Firefox和Chrome开发了一个附加组件.它有内容脚本.我想在浏览器选项卡的控制台中访问它们(在Firefox Web控制台上).例如,我想输入在控制台的内容脚本中定义的全局变量,它将输出其值.
在Chrome中,我可以通过按下打开控制台F12,然后导航到开发人员工具中的控制台选项卡.它在过滤器按钮后面有一个dropbox,用于选择我所在的上下文(页面/内容脚本):

在Firefox中,如何做同样的事情?
firefox firefox-addon firefox-developer-tools firefox-addon-webextensions
网站有一个弹出窗口,您可以在其中向某人发送消息。消息发送后,弹出窗口关闭。我想查看 Firefox Developer 窗口中发出的请求,但它会在弹出窗口关闭时关闭。有没有办法保持弹出窗口打开或保持开发工具打开?这个问题与有关 Chrome 开发工具的问题类似。
当我尝试进入copy内部时,Chrome会抱怨setTimeout.
setTimeout(function () { copy('a') }, 0)
Uncaught ReferenceError: copy is not defined
at <anonymous>:1:26
Run Code Online (Sandbox Code Playgroud)
它也不适用于window范围.
setTimeout(function () { window.copy('a') }, 0)
Uncaught TypeError: window.copy is not a function
Run Code Online (Sandbox Code Playgroud)
有趣的是,如果我保留引用copy并重用它,它就可以工作
cc = copy;
setTimeout(function () { cc('a') }, 0);
Run Code Online (Sandbox Code Playgroud)
在Firefox中,它不会抛出任何错误,但即使使用保存的引用它也不起作用.
为什么copy功能不起作用setTimeout,这是一个错误吗?
javascript firefox google-chrome google-chrome-devtools firefox-developer-tools
我正在使用 Firefox,想要分析页面的请求/响应。
有没有办法在进入/打开页面(自动打开第二个选项卡)之前打开开发人员工具( firefox-developer-tools ) - 即“网络”。
否则将无法正确跟踪流量。
我正在 Firefox 中调试 API 请求,我希望在开发人员工具的网络面板中过滤多个域。我可以使用 过滤一个域domain:domainname.com,但如何添加其他域?
firefox ×8
javascript ×4
firefox-addon-webextensions ×2
ajax ×1
firebug ×1
response ×1
typescript ×1